		<description>Sometimes writers will go to any length to support their position be it correct or not.  I have been guilty of same.

However it should be noted that of Amir's fouls (3)

1.  The first was due to Rip pushing him into a defender while Amir was attempting to set a screen for him.

2.  The 3rd was called on a blocked shot with which Champion, Mahorn and the Palace crowd all vehemently disagreed.

As far as rebounds go an objective observer would look at how MC is using Amir on defense.   Obviously if he is playing away from the basket pressuring the ball he isn't going to get a lot of rebounds.</description>

		<description>The problem that he has, is sometimes he gets caught up under the basket and doesn’t box and doesn’t get the guy out the paint&#62;&#62;

Boxing is positioning and strength and quickness

Getting the guy out of the paint is strength.

I think that Amir can improve his boxing out abilities with experience and coaching.

Getting the guy out of the paint will require a lot more protein and carbs in the diet and a lot more work in the weight room.  That will take a couple of years.</description>

		<description>Amir's going to make a billion mistakes, but Curry SHOULD love him and Maxiell and Afflalo because they are the live-wired energy players that Curry seeks to employ for more pressure on defense.  Tayshaun has cooled to Rasheed's level of intelligence-concentrated D - the youthful abandon has left both guys, no matter how many yelps and words Rasheed bellows in disagreement.  Both are better defenders than what Amir, Afflalo, or Maxiell can achieve, but the energy by the latter three will make up for their inexperience.  If Curry's even a half-point more adept at substitutions than Flip Saunders, then this team could lead the league in a 03-04 kind of way - the key word of the goal is "smothering" ... that word's been missing since Flip appeared.</description>
